Dive Transient:

  • In a brand new bid to shut the digital divide, college students who obtain Pell Grants will probably be amongst these qualifying for high-speed web subsidies underneath a program announced Monday by the Biden administration.
  • The White Home estimates nearly 40% of American households will probably be eligible for subsidies reducing web prices to not more than $30 a month underneath the administration’s $14.2 billion Inexpensive Connectivity Program. 
  • That is doable via secured commitments from 20 web service suppliers promising to decrease costs or elevate web speeds for eligible households, based on the announcement. Federal businesses will start to achieve out to households that qualify for ACP primarily based on their revenue or participation in federal packages, together with free or reduced-price college meals, Pell Grants, Medicaid, Particular Vitamin Program for Girls, Infants, and Kids, and others. 

Dive Perception:

Challenges persist to attach eligible households to broadband packages like ACP, stated Doug Casey, board chair of the State Instructional Know-how Administrators Affiliation. 

It’ll take creativity on the native stage to construct relationships and partnerships with households to unfold the phrase and get those that are eligible to enroll. From there, Casey stated, localities can share their suggestions to the federal stage, as a result of there’s not a one-size-fits-all nationwide strategy. 

To date, 11.5 million of the estimated 48 million eligible households are benefittng from ACP, which is funded by the bipartisan Infrastructure Funding and Jobs Act enacted in November, the White Home announcement stated. 

The newest web supplier commitments imply eligible ACP households will typically be capable to obtain high-speed broadband without charge, President Joe Biden stated in a information convention Monday asserting these enhancements. 

“This implies quick web, good obtain speeds, with no information caps and no additional charges for thousands and thousands of American households,” Biden stated.   

The White Home’s transfer to safe extra entry to the ACP program comes as Los Angeles Unified College District, the second largest college system within the U.S., introduced its personal $50 million effort to offer high-speed web to its households to deal with the college system’s digital divide. 

Whereas Casey stays optimistic about Biden’s efforts to attach extra households to broadband, he stated he has seen comparable efforts battle in Connecticut. Casey can be the chief director of the Connecticut Fee for Instructional Know-how, which the state Basic Meeting established to combine expertise into faculties, libraries, schools and universities.

For example, Connecticut Gov. Ned Lamont launched a $43.5 million initiative in summer season 2020 to shut the digital divide for college students by offering 50,000 laptops, connecting 60,000 college students to at-home web entry for a 12 months and creating 200 public hotspots. Even with this funding, Casey stated, not as many Connecticut households took up the provide as anticipated. 

“While you give individuals free broadband and also you’re speaking to them and also you assume you’ve reached them, you continue to haven’t,” he stated. “That you must inform them repeatedly and once more from a number of factors of view that this service is on the market and, extra importantly, that it’s invaluable.”

Individuals might be hesitant to enroll, as a result of in a world stuffed with scams it will not be initially apparent packages like ACP aren’t making an attempt to idiot eligible households, Casey stated. There will also be language limitations, he stated, for households residing within the U.S. with out authorized permission who don’t really feel comfy sharing their data to show eligibility. Or some individuals simply don’t see the worth or don’t need web of their properties, Casey added. 

Whereas it’s thrilling entry to this system has expanded, Casey stated it’s equally promising that federal businesses will attain out to eligible ACP households they already work with underneath different packages. 

EducationSuperHighway, a nonprofit targeted on closing the digital divide, has developed a free online toolkit for varsity districts to assist eligible households enroll in ACP. Based on a fall report by the group, 18.1 million individuals stay in communities with broadband infrastructure however can’t afford to attach. 

The important thing function districts can play is to drive consciousness about ACP, Jack Lynch, chief working officer of EducationSuperHighway told K-12 Dive earlier this 12 months.

“College districts, they’re a trusted messenger to their households,” he stated. “College districts can play a giant function in serving to to get the phrase out.”
